Delhi Capitals has announced the name of the captain of its women’s team on the morning of March 2 on its official Twitter handle. For the first season of the Women’s Premier League (WPL), Delhi Capitals have chosen Australia’s world champion player Meg Lanning as their captain. This league is going to start from 4th March. Delhi Capitals will play their first match against RCB on 5 March.
If we talk about Meg Lanning, she is one of the best captains in the world in women’s cricket. She has won five ICC trophies as captain. In this case, he is also ahead of the two best captains of men’s cricket, Ricky Ponting (4) and MS Dhoni (3). Recently, under his captaincy, the Australian team won the T20 World Cup 2023. She has also won the World Cup for Australia seven times as a player. His captaincy record is excellent. In such a situation, it can be said that the Delhi Capitals team has found their lady luck.
Delhi Capitals schedule for WPL
- vs RCB, March 5 (Brabourne Stadium)
- vs UP Warriors, March 7 (DY Patil Stadium)
- vs Mumbai Indians, March 9 (DY Patil Stadium)
- vs Gujarat Giants, March 11 (DY Patil Stadium)
- vs RCB, March 13 (DY Patil Stadium)
- vs Gujarat Giants, 16 March (Brabourne Stadium)
- vs Mumbai Indians, 20 March (DY Patil Stadium)
- vs UP Warriors, 21 March (Brabourne Stadium)
Full squad of Delhi Capitals women’s team
Jemimah Rodrigues, Meg Lanning (c), Shafali Verma, Radha Yadav, Shikha Pandey, Marijan Kapp, Titus Sadhu, Alice Capsey, Tara Norris, Laura Harris, Jasia Akhtar, Minu Mani, Arundhati Reddy, Tania Bhatia, Poonam Yadav, Jess Jonassen , Sneha Deepti and Aparna Mandal.
